Comprehensive Taiwan "United Daily News" reported that a 101-year-old Taiwanese woman surnamed Zhang, who lives in a nursing home due to severe dementia, has received notices from the Taoyuan District Court three times since last year and was selected to serve as " Citizen judges,” that is, jurors. The old man's daughter repeatedly reported in different forms that her mother's condition was unable to serve as a "citizen judge", but received no response. She even received another notice on June 27 asking her mother to go through the "citizen judge" selection process. The old man's daughter said: "Too outrageous"! In this regard, the Taoyuan District Court stated that it is understanding the situation and will make further announcements later if there are further results.

The daughter of this 101-year-old Taiwanese woman said that she first received a notice from the Taoyuan District Court in August last year that her 100-year-old mother was chosen to be a "citizen judge" because her mother was already suffering from severe dementia and Unable to speak or walk, she was admitted to a nursing home in Taoyuan City three years ago. The old man’s daughter explained her mother’s condition to the Taoyuan District Court in an registered letter , stating that she was not suitable to serve as a “citizen judge.” However, they later received a notice from the court saying that their mother had been picked again. The old man’s daughter called the Taoyuan District Court to explain the situation, but was told that the handling section chief was not available to answer the phone and the matter was dropped. Unexpectedly, on June 27, the old man received a notice from the Taoyuan District Court for the third time, requiring him to report to the court on the morning of August 16 and participate in the trial proceedings of the murder case. The old man’s daughter couldn’t help but lament that the selection process of “citizen judges” was out of control. What's the problem? Why would a centenarian and demented man be invited to participate in the trial? It's really outrageous!

In response to this matter, the Taoyuan District Court stated on the evening of June 28 that it was understanding the situation, and if there are further results, it will be explained later.

"Citizen Judge" is the most important project listed by the Democratic Progressive Party authorities as "judicial reform." For this purpose, Taiwan's judicial institutions have spent a huge amount of money to renovate courts, hold mock courts, and invite director Wu Nien-chen to shoot promotional videos, etc., but in actual operation However, there are various situations, and even a centenarian woman with dementia may be selected to serve as a "national judge", which makes the people puzzled and surprised.
